The Beechy Rail Trail follows much of the original path of the narrow gauge railway which ran from 1902 to 1962. From Beech Forest most of the trail is downhill to Gellibrand. The path then continues onto Colac. Gellibrand is a perfect place to stop for a drink at the Gellibrand General Store or at the pub.
The train used to run to Crowes near Lavers Hill. The Crowes buffer stop is just near Melba Gully rainforest walk,(signposted just west of Lavers Hill)
